    Understanding Your JF Starter Motor

    Alright, before we jump into fixing anything, let's get acquainted with the star of the show: the JF starter motor. Knowing how it works is the first step to fixing it. The JF starter motor, like any other starter motor, is essentially a high-powered electric motor that's designed to crank your engine and get it started. When you turn the key or push the start button, this motor swings into action. It gets its power directly from your car's battery and uses that power to spin a gear called the pinion gear. This pinion gear meshes with the flywheel of your engine, causing the engine to turn over and start. Sounds simple, right? It kind of is, but there are a few key components that work together to make this happen. First off, you've got the motor itself. This is where the magic happens, with electromagnets and a spinning armature converting electrical energy into mechanical energy. Then there's the solenoid, which acts like a switch and pushes the pinion gear into contact with the flywheel. It's also responsible for supplying power to the starter motor. Finally, there are the brushes, which transfer power to the rotating armature. Think of them as the gatekeepers of the electrical current.     Key Components and Their Functions

    Let's break down those key components a little further, shall we? First up, we have the motor itself. This is the heart of the starter, consisting of a series of electromagnets and a rotating armature. When electricity flows through the motor, it creates a magnetic field that spins the armature, providing the mechanical force needed to crank the engine. Next, there's the solenoid. This is a small, but mighty, electromagnetic switch. It serves two main purposes. Firstly, it pushes the pinion gear (that little gear that engages with the flywheel) out to connect with the engine. Secondly, it acts as a high-current switch, sending power to the starter motor. The solenoid is crucial because it ensures the starter motor only activates when you want it to. Then we have the pinion gear. This gear is mounted on the starter motor shaft and is designed to mesh with the engine's flywheel. When the solenoid activates, it pushes the pinion gear into the flywheel, allowing the starter motor to turn the engine. Brushes are essential parts too. These small carbon or copper components transfer electrical current from the battery to the rotating armature inside the motor. As the armature spins, the brushes maintain contact, ensuring a continuous flow of power. These brushes wear out over time. If they're worn down, the starter motor won't work properly.     Common Issues with JF Starter Motors

    Now that you know the players, let's talk about the problems. JF starter motors, like any mechanical component, aren't immune to issues. Here are some of the most common problems you might encounter. First off, we have the dreaded "no crank" situation. You turn the key, and...nothing. No clicking, no noise, just silence. This could be due to a dead battery, a faulty solenoid, a broken wire, or a seized motor. Then there's the "clicking" sound. This indicates that the solenoid is working, but the motor isn't engaging. This is often due to a problem with the pinion gear not meshing properly with the flywheel. Next up, the starter might spin but not engage the engine. You hear the motor whirring, but the engine doesn't turn over. This usually points to a worn-out pinion gear or a problem with the one-way clutch inside the starter. There's also the sluggish cranking issue. The engine turns over, but it does so slowly and with difficulty. This often indicates a weak battery, worn brushes, or a partially seized motor. Finally, there's the intermittent failure. The starter works sometimes, but not always. This can be caused by a loose connection, a worn solenoid, or an internal problem within the motor.     Troubleshooting: When Things Go Wrong

    Okay, so the moment of truth has arrived – your JF starter motor isn't behaving. Don't panic! Here's a step-by-step guide to troubleshooting: First off, check the battery. Sounds obvious, but it's the most common culprit. Make sure your battery has enough juice by checking the voltage with a multimeter. Anything below 12 volts could be a problem. Then, inspect the connections. Check the battery terminals, the starter motor connections, and the ground wires for corrosion or looseness. Clean them if necessary. Next, listen for the sound. Does it click, whir, or nothing at all? The sound can tell you a lot. A click suggests a problem with the solenoid or the connection to the starter motor. No sound at all points to a dead battery or a broken connection. Then, you can test the solenoid. You can do this by jumping the solenoid terminals with a screwdriver. Be careful, and make sure the car is in park and the parking brake is engaged! If the starter cranks when you jump the terminals, the solenoid is likely the problem. Finally, visually inspect the starter motor for any signs of damage, such as broken wires or leaks. If you are comfortable, you can remove the starter motor and inspect it further. Troubleshooting is a process of elimination. Don't be afraid to try different things and to consult with a professional if you're not sure. Remember, safety first! Always disconnect the negative battery cable before working on any electrical components. This step-by-step process enables you to methodically diagnose your JF starter motor problems.     Preventative Maintenance Tips

    Want to avoid future starter motor problems? Here are some preventative maintenance tips to keep your JF starter motor running smoothly. First, keep your battery in good shape. A weak battery puts extra strain on the starter motor. Make sure to regularly test your battery and replace it when needed. Keep the connections clean. Corrosion can cause electrical resistance and damage your starter. Clean the battery terminals, starter motor connections, and ground wires regularly with a wire brush and contact cleaner. Don't crank the engine for extended periods. If the engine doesn't start right away, don't keep cranking it. This can overheat the starter motor and cause damage. Schedule regular checkups. Have a mechanic inspect your starter motor during routine maintenance. They can identify potential problems before they become major issues. Use quality components. When replacing any part of the starter motor, use high-quality components to ensure durability and reliability. Regular maintenance helps to ensure the longevity of your JF starter motor.     Finding a Reliable Mechanic

    So, you need to find a mechanic? Here are some tips. Ask for recommendations. Ask friends, family, or other car owners for recommendations of trusted mechanics in your area. Read online reviews. Check online review sites for feedback from other customers about the mechanic's services and reputation. Verify certifications. Make sure the mechanic is certified by a reputable organization, like the National Institute for Automotive Service Excellence (ASE). Check their experience. Ask about the mechanic's experience with starter motor repairs. Experience is a good indicator of their skill level. Get a quote. Ask for a detailed quote before authorizing any repairs, so you know what to expect. Get a warranty. Make sure the mechanic offers a warranty on their work. A warranty provides peace of mind in case there are any issues after the repair. By taking these steps, you can find a reliable mechanic who can effectively diagnose and repair your JF starter motor.
